Inland Empire Industrial MarketBeat Q1 2026
The Inland Empire industrial market experienced rising vacancy and negative net absorption in Q1 2026, with the overall vacancy rate increasing to 8.5% and year-to-date net absorption turning sharply negative at 3.4 million square feet, driven primarily by four large tenant move-outs exceeding 1 million square feet each. Regional employment growth remained modest at 0.9% year-over-year with declines in industrial-relevant sectors including construction, professional services, and manufacturing, while direct asking rents declined 6.2% quarter-over-quarter to $1.05 per square foot per month as elevated vacancy continued to pressure pricing across all submarkets.
